Responsibilities
- Commission new distributed digital control systems on construction sites within planned timelines
- Document commissioning details; communicate deficiencies and progress
- Act as the Lead Technician and plan work with Team Leader
- Network technologies: Perform data back-up from data servers and create automated back-up procedures
- Troubleshoot and resolve inconsistencies in the functions or sequence of operations
- Configure PC workstations and user interfaces
- Confirm proper network performance
- Operational testing, verification, and acceptance: Run routine reports to review system operation
- Perform final inspection, testing and customer acceptance
- Provide customer training on system operations
- Complete and submit routine written reports
- Provide plans and control system documents to engineering for as-built drawings
- Project site communication and coordination: Coordinate trade contractors to perform startup services
- Work Overtime as needed (Compressed schedule performance can be a factor and will require extended hours to meet commitments)
- Work Rotational On-Call and/or Minimal Overnight Travel
- Submit accurate time and expense reports
- Adhere to local, corporate, and OSHA safety policies and procedures
Requirements
- Basic Qualifications: 3+ years of experience with Electro-mechanical systems and user PC/software (either in a previous role or through education)
- Demonstrated on-the-job experience with: Integration of low voltage building sub-systems industry protocols, such as LON, BACnet, N2, Modbus, etc.
- Reading, understanding, and interpreting design and construction documents
- Ability and willingness to work in a variety of circumstances, including climbing ladders, scaffolds, and high lift equipment, working in ducts, crawl spaces, roofs, basements, above ceilings, and in various conditions
- Must be able to use hand tools, laptop, email, smartphone, and tablet as well as able to carry and move equipment and tools weighing up to 75 pounds unassisted
- Experience with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, and Outlook)
- Must be able to work overtime and on-call as needed
- Must be 18 years of age and possess a valid driver's license with limited violations; must meet eligibility requirements to participate in Siemens' fleet vehicle program
